119140967 | 3 months ago | It has been a while since I've lived in the area and so I can't go look and for all I know the shop might be gone now. IIRC they sold all kinds of smoking accessories. That's not my cup of tea so I never went in to learn more. Their website shows mostly vapes now so shop=e-cigarette might work, but I think not all "smoke shops" sell e-cigarettes. shop=headshop might not be wrong either, but again, not every "smoke shop" sold cannabis paraphernalia. shop=tobacco and shop=smartshop are definitely not appropriate. I don't think there are very many of those around. I started using the shop=smoke_shop tag because that's what they call themselves and none of the other tags are close. It seemed like a reasonable time to use ATYL instead of trying to pretend it's another type of shop. I see it's been used a handful of times since then (13 total, 5 of them from me in this neighborhood). |

143715522 | over 1 year ago | Hi Jacob, welcome to the OpenStreetMap community and thanks for mapping bicycle parking in this area! I see you requested a review for this change. The only issue is that the bicycle parking nodes should be separate and next to the sidewalk way. Also the access=yes tag is not necessary as that is the default. Also, I noticed you added some parking lanes in other changesets. If you want to map this information, it can be more easily added to the highway object itself using the parking:lane=* tag. A separate way would only be necessary in a parking lot or if there was some physical barrier between the road and the parking. Let me know if you have any questions about this! |
